Added more aggressive errors for resource loading

This commit is contained in:
DallonF
2012-08-15 14:08:38 -07:00
parent 2dc60f923b
commit d580671000

View File

@@ -145,8 +145,15 @@ util.inherits(Server, http.Server);
Server.prototype.listen = function(port, host) {
var server = this;
config.loadConfig('./', server, function(err, resourcesInstances) {
server.resources = resourcesInstances;
http.Server.prototype.listen.call(server, port || server.options.port, host || server.options.host);
if (err) {
console.log("Error loading resources: ");
console.log(err.stack);
process.exit();
} else {
server.resources = resourcesInstances;
http.Server.prototype.listen.call(server, port || server.options.port, host || server.options.host);
}
});
return this;
};